Output 31b81c104bf7009f9952f3e8752b6ef92434401a1f2997d7cc75ac8f2e674ceb:3

value
7750500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1aa380b81b5834a0e4aaedefe8ed30e9f5ead3e2 OP_EQUALVERIFY OP_CHECKSIG
address
13RrSMzZUUKywgYyX4T7wWDhrkQuAaUSXw
transaction
31b81c104bf7009f9952f3e8752b6ef92434401a1f2997d7cc75ac8f2e674ceb
spent
true